Carnarvon Energy's Accounts Payable for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2025 was €0.09 Mil.

Carnarvon Energy's quarterly Accounts Payable increased from Dec. 2024 (€0.10 Mil) to Jun. 2025 (€0.11 Mil) but then declined from Jun. 2025 (€0.11 Mil) to Dec. 2025 (€0.09 Mil).

Carnarvon Energy's annual Accounts Payable declined from Jun. 2023 (€0.65 Mil) to Jun. 2024 (€0.11 Mil) but then stayed the same from Jun. 2024 (€0.11 Mil) to Jun. 2025 (€0.11 Mil).

Carnarvon Energy Accounts Payable Calculation

Accounts Payable represents any money that a company owes its suppliers for goods and services purchased on credit and is expected to pay within the next year or operating cycle.

Carnarvon Energy Business Description

Industry EnergyOil & Gas
Other Exchanges CVONF:USACVN:Australia
Address 76 Kings Park Road, 2nd Floor, West Perth, Perth, WA, AUS, 6005
Carnarvon Energy Ltd is engaged in oil and gas exploration, development, and production in Australia. It holds interests in the Dorado and Pavo oil and condensate developments in the Bedout Basin, located on the North-West Shelf, offshore Western Australia.
